Quianta Moore, the executive director of The Hackett Center for Mental Health, spoke with KPRC’s Haley Hernandez about the impact of the Brain Builders program, a free, online initiative aimed at mothers to help support the brain development of their children.
“There’s a ton of research showing that this investment in the early years helps to build brain resilience so that even if later on there’s a trauma or life circumstance, they’re able to bounce back from that easier than if those strong neural connections weren’t made in a healthy way,” Moore explained.
